Experience a **transformative graphic novel adaptation** of George R. R. Martin’s iconic A Game of Thrones, brought to life by acclaimed novelist Daniel Abraham and illustrator Tommy Patterson. This edition features over fifty pages of exclusive content, including a new Preface by Martin himself and early renderings of beloved characters, making it a must-read for fans of the saga.
As **winter descends upon Westeros**, Eddard Stark of Winterfell prepares to host King Robert Baratheon, only to find himself ensnared in a deadly web of political intrigue and familial loyalty. With dark forces lurking beyond the Wall and secrets unraveling within the court, every choice Eddard makes could alter the fate of the kingdoms forever.
This graphic novel not only revitalizes a literary classic for a new generation but also offers a behind-the-scenes look at the creative process, showcasing the dedication behind its production. It promises to captivate and resonate with both long-time fans and newcomers to the series alike.
